Transaction 52ddf33c280b02414327c0dcd5cf359e2a9458b30a234dea28261a714c7abb79

1 Input
2 Outputs
  • 52ddf33c280b02414327c0dcd5cf359e2a9458b30a234dea28261a714c7abb79:0
  • value  19331600
    address  3CuWVjj4hZLaNsnZLko3qzvW7EixK3xSia
  • 52ddf33c280b02414327c0dcd5cf359e2a9458b30a234dea28261a714c7abb79:1
  • value  328000
    address  1HUq3vW4oGhtJp7i8jpB1Uo1wsjECabQUr